Yield Guild Games partners with 8 new Play-to-Earn Games

- Advertisement -

Yield Guild Games, a Filipino-led decentralized gaming guild that lends gaming NFT assets to players so they can start playing and earning from blockchain games with no upfront cost, announced it has partnered with and invested in eight NFT games from October 2021, namely Influence, CyBall, Thetan Arena, KOGs SLAM!, MOBOX, Aavegotchi, DeHorizon, and Genopets. Established in late 2020, YGG now has over 18 leading games in its portfolio for the benefit of its players including Axie Infinity, Splinterlands, Zed Run, and others.

After generating a total US$22.4M earlier this year, with US$9.9M raised via an initial round led by Delphi Digital, an intermediate round led by BITKRAFT, and an advanced round led by a16z, plus an initial sale of its tokens to gamers for US$12.5M, YGG is using the funds to purchase assets in leading NFT games for the purpose of providing its community with opportunities to play and earn income in blockchain-based game economies. A full overview of YGG’s crypto assets can be found in their latest Asset & Treasury Report.

“Community involvement is a key factor of any potential YGG game purchase,” said Sarutobi Sasuke, Head of Partnerships at YGG, describing YGG’s approach to assessing the opportunity associated with various NFT games. “The team reviews the gameplay and game economics to ensure that the games have a robust and fair game economy that rewards players adequately for the time and effort put in by them,” he said, adding that it is also important for the game to have a guild, team, or league component as it incentivizes group effort among the guild’s scholars.

Below is an overview of YGG’s most recently announced game partnerships including details of the in-game assets the guild has purchased as well as the benefit they will deliver to players.

1.     Influence

Influence is an immersive space strategy massively multiplayer online game (MMO) that offers engaging gameplay along with true ownership of NFT game assets. Players compete through multiple avenues including mining, building, trading, researching, and fighting, and interact in an immersive 3D universe through third-person control of their ships and the installations they build. Through the introduction of their soon-to-launch token, SWAY, which players can earn through gameplay, Influence allows players to facilitate in-game transactions for resources, components, ships, and asteroids.

YGG has purchased the 46th largest Asteroid in Influence, KJ-44947, a C-Type carbonaceous asteroid. In addition to this, YGG has also acquired approximately 30 smaller asteroids for the YGG community to use.

2.     CyBall

CyBall is a soccer-themed, cyberpunk-esque play-to-earn game where players can collect, trade, mentor, and battle CyBlocs, which are fantasy cyborg characters represented as collectible and tradable NFTs on the blockchain. Players train their CyBlocs to compete in various game modes with varying levels of rewards. Existing CyBlocs can also “mentor” junior CyBlocs, creating the next generation of unique NFTs.

In partnership with CyBall, YGG acquired part of the initial Genesis CyBloc NFT packs, which will enable YGG to equip at least 1,000 CyBall scholars right from the start.

3.     Thetan Arena

This mobile-friendly multiplayer online battle arena (MOBA) game allows players to gather friends, form a team, battle with others, and earn token rewards with a combination of gaming skills and teamwork. The game is available in free-to-play mode, where players can earn in-game tokens called Thetan Coin (THC). Alongside this, the game has a play-to-earn mode with more token-earning opportunities using Premium Heroes.

YGG participated in Thetan Arena’s token sale and acquired 250 Common Heroes, 100 Epic Heroes, and 50 Legendary Heroes.

4.     KOGs SLAM!

Developed by RFOX, KOGs SLAM! is a blockchain mobile game with rules similar to the POGs game that became a phenomenon in the 1990s. However, KOGs SLAM! comes in an evolved digital form that uses NFT collectibles as game pieces to play with and earn rewards. Keys to Other Games (KOGs) are “Šcollectible, playable, tradable, slammable NFTs that can be used only on the WAX blockchain. KOGs SLAM! introduces a play-to-earn model to millions of users in the Southeast Asian region where players can win KOGs and in-game tokens called KOINS from daily missions and tournaments, right from the get-go, and trade their winnings for real-life earnings.

YGG has also acquired one of two Marquee Brand SHOPs in the Gaming quarter of the RFOX VALT, an interactive and fully immersive shopping experience that combines gaming elements and forms its own standalone Metaverse virtual reality. YGG members will be able to visit YGG’s SHOP to interact with the community, collect NFTs, play games, and much more, all in VR.

5.     MOBOX

A leading project on the Binance Smart Chain, MOBOX is a community-driven gaming platform that combines yield farming and in-game NFTs to create a free-to-play and play-to-earn ecosystem. MOBOX has released four titles under its platform, namely MOMO: Block Brawl, MOMO: Token Master, MOMO: Farmer, and Trade Action. MBOX, the native governance token of the MOBOX DAO, can be implemented to acquire additional characters, lottery wheels, and incentives.

YGG has acquired five YGG-branded Legendary MOMO NFTs along with 100 KEYS that can be utilized across all MOBOX titles to farm MBOX tokens.

6.     Aavegotchi

Aavegotchi brings back the nostalgia of the virtual pet game Tamagotchi, only this time with pixelated ghosts that inhabit the Ethereum blockchain and make use of the Polygon network. Backed by the ERC-721 standard, these NFTs are valued by their rarity level, which is calculated via multiple factors, including base traits, equipped wearables, and amount of staked collateral such as interest-bearing tokens from the Aave Protocol. A player can visit their land by connecting their wallets and rent it out to Aavegotchis to share a split of the farming yield and unlock more farming potential, as well as the full breadth of social and exploratory gameplay.

YGG and its subDAOs Yield Guild SEA (South East Asia) and Yield Guild ASIA have purchased exclusive YGG-themed land plots (REALM parcels) along with Aavegotchi avatars. Wearables will also be acquired in preparation for gameplay when the Gotchiverse goes live in December of this year.

7.     DeHorizon

YGG scholars can also jump into the epic fantasy world of the DeHorizon metaverse, where players can play for fun and to earn. Built on Ethereum-EVM compatible chains, DeHorizon games will let players explore the open world of epic battles, minting NFT monsters, mining resources, embarking on heroic quests, taming wild creatures, and much more. DeHorizon games include group-versus-group adventure game DeVerse, weekly-based battle royale DeTournament, dragon-riding fantasy sports game DeQuidditch, and much more.

YGG has made a purchase of assets in DeHorizon games that include exclusive weapons, equipment, a Dragon racing team, a DeMeta Pass ID, and 40 monsters called JuJus, which will also be specially customized to represent YGG.

8.     Genopets

YGG also continued to expand its collection of game assets within the Solana ecosystem by partnering with Genopets, a play-to-earn game at the forefront of incorporating move-to-play mechanics and incentivizing physical activity. Genopets are generative NFTs that evolve and can be upgraded and customized with eight variable bionic features and extremities, falling under the category of one of five elemental types. Combining the nurturing of Tamagotchi with the training and battling of Pokémon through asynchronous puzzle mini-games, the game converts users’ real-life movement into XP (experience points) to progress in-game.

YGG has purchased custom-branded Genopets Habitats along with Genopets governance tokens called GENE.
